Output 74586020f9193704e372796d78322fa94a677cbfca12270da8a905004055ace6:152

value
380267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ac8d2e5e0f5948ba366cf95f267e6a1cbaf7876b OP_EQUAL
address
3HRPGyW32g6Cqra158noZWEHtjx6oSLXUy
transaction
74586020f9193704e372796d78322fa94a677cbfca12270da8a905004055ace6
spent
true